Upgraded and LNG-powered SPIRIT OF BRITISH COLUMBIA back in service
jun 06 2018
FerryAs Shippax reported in last month's edition of ShippaxInfo, BC Ferries’1992-built SPIRIT OF BRITISH COLUMBIA successfully underwent her mid-life upgrade and LNG retrofit at Remontowa in Poland, sailing back for Canada, through the Panama Canal, on the last day of March. The ship arrived in Vancouver in early May and has been reintroduced on the Tsawassan-Swartz Bay route today, 6 June.
